Umidigi X vs BLU G90

Specification | Umidigi X | BLU G90 |
---|---|---|
OS | Android v9.0 (Pie) | Android v10 |
Display | 6.3 inches, 1080 x 2340 pixels | 6.5 inches, 720 x 1600 pixels |
RAM | 6 GB | 4 GB |
Battery | 4000 mAh, Li-Po Battery | 4000 mAh, Li-Po Battery |
CPU | 2.1 GHz, Octa Core Processor | 1.8 GHz, Octa Core Processor |
Price | ₹17,990 | ₹10,999 |
